Russia, Imperial. An Order of St. Vladimir, IV Class in Gold, Civil Division, c.1830 Archive The goal of the VERDINASO( ). Instituted September 22nd, 1782. In 14K Gold, a beautiful St. Vladimir in the form of a cross pattee with red and black bulbous enamel arms (typical of early produced crosses), with delicately hand painted insignia, the reverse inscribed in Russian with the institution date September 22, 1782, on a loop for suspension with original ribbon, loop marked with French Gold import mark, measures 34. 5 mm (w) x 39. 5mm (h), weighs (with original ribbon)
